The size of Deebing Heights is approximately 10.5 square kilometres. There is 1 park, covering nearly 0.2% of the total area. The population of Deebing Heights in 2016 was 2039 people. By 2021 the population was 3960 showing a population growth of 94.2%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Deebing Heights is 30-39 years. Households in Deebing Heights are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Deebing Heights work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 63.40% of the homes in Deebing Heights were owner-occupied compared with 69.60% in 2016.
